How seats are allotted in IIT?
JoSAA allots seats to candidates in IITs according to their All India Ranks scored in JEE Advanced. JEE Advanced 2023 Counselling is expected to begin in September 2023. A total of 23 IITs are part of JoSAA Counselling 2023 with more than 16,000 seats.

How many seats are there in NIT for general category?
All 31 NITs together have 23,997 undergraduate seats and 13,664 postgraduate seats as of 2021. The seats available for the general category students, the reservation ratios, and other supplementary seats are also clearly mentioned.

Can a poor student get admission in IIT?
There are scholarship programs which provides fee remission for economically backward students in an IIT. Many NGOs also work in this regard which provide free scholarship for the students who are from the economically backward section.

How seats are allotted in JoSAA?
The authorities conducts six rounds of JoSAA seat allocation. It is done on the basis of the merit of the candidates, category, selected preferences and availability of seats. Candidates who will be allotted seats have to download the provisional seat allotment letter and an e-challan to remit seat acceptance fee.
